Output e38ebccd695a5c3fa8beeceeb7ced300ba631a6a95d4cf669f3ac0a10975060e:108

value
680780
script pubkey
OP_0 OP_PUSHBYTES_32 c59622b3ba6fd06a4a37dd6e426bcf8ea46103a5ed5d19bbb1dba55f05c15ab9
address
bc1qcktz9va6dlgx5j3hm4hyy67036jxzqa9a4w3nwa3mwj47pwpt2us9dclzq
transaction
e38ebccd695a5c3fa8beeceeb7ced300ba631a6a95d4cf669f3ac0a10975060e
spent
true